The assumption of risk amp is a legal concept that allows individuals to voluntarily accept the known risks associated with an activity, thereby waiving their right to pursue legal action against the provider of that activity in case of injury or loss.
Generally, participants in activities that carry inherent risks, such as sports or recreational events, may be required to sign an assumption of risk amp. Organizations that run such activities might also need to file this document to protect themselves from liability.
To fill out an assumption of risk amp, individuals typically need to provide their personal information, acknowledge the risks associated with the activity, and sign the document. Additional details about the activity and the date may also be required.
The purpose of the assumption of risk amp is to inform participants about the risks involved in an activity and to obtain their consent, thereby limiting the liability of the organizers or providers of the activity.
The assumption of risk amp must typically include information such as the participant's name, the nature of the activity, acknowledgment of risks, date of participation, and signatures from both the participant and, if applicable, a guardian.
